The week two NFL schedule will kickoff with a Thursday night matchup between the Cincinnati Bengals and the Cleveland Browns from FirstEnergy Stadium. On Sunday, Cincinnati K Randy Bullock missed a 31-yard field goal in the last few seconds during a 16-13 home loss versus the Los Angeles Chargers. The Bengals were outgained by a 362-295 margin and turned the ball over twice in defeat.

Number one overall draft pick Joe Burrow threw for 193 yards and ran for a 23-yard touchdown in his NFL debut. Joe Mixon rushed for 69 yards and lost a fumble in a losing effort for the Bengals.

The Cleveland Browns have lost 16th straight season openers and will be looking forward to playing on a short week. On Sunday, rookie head coach Kevin Stefanski and Cleveland were overmatched during a 38-6 road loss against Baltimore. The Browns turned the ball over three times and committed eight penalties for 80 yards on the afternoon.

Cleveland QB Baker Mayfield threw for 189 yards and a touchdown, while finishing with a subpar 65.0 QBR. TE David Njoku hauled in three passes for 50 yards and a score for the Browns.

Cleveland TE David Njoku (knee) has been placed on injured reserve and will not be eligible to return until week five.
